Q: Is 46,010,233 a Prime Number?
A: No, 46,010,233 is not a prime number.
A prime number is a natural number, greater than one, that can only be divided by 1 and itself.
The number 46010233 can be evenly divided by 1 1,303 35,311 and 46,010,233, with no remainder.
Since 46,010,233 cannot be divided by just 1 and 46,010,233, it is not a prime number.
